Accident summary

On Thursday 1 September 1994 at 14:30 a slight collision occurred near A71 involving 2 vehicles (nissan bluebird, toyota corolla) and 1 casualty (1 slight) Weather at the time was recorded as fine no high winds. Road surface conditions were dry. Lighting was described as daylight.
